Transaction 66bb861103b41471b34b1e9fe289d2c82a1c10de4cd81250d70300d14b2423d7

2 Input
1 Outputs
  • 66bb861103b41471b34b1e9fe289d2c82a1c10de4cd81250d70300d14b2423d7:0
  • value  321114
    address  37TFgSzoABWa8GsAGYB6hLWYAjEedGqKmE